LOCKPORT — Troopers out of SP Lockport responded to Beattie Ave in the town of Lockport for a vehicle collision involving a pedestrian on Sept. 4 at 6:52 a.m.
Investigation determined that a 2004 Ford Explorer was traveling southbound on Beattie Ave.
The Ford exited the roadway to the east where it traveled through a front yard striking a parked vehicle in a driveway.
The parked vehicle subsequently struck a 15-year-old male, who was waiting for the school bus.
The 15-year-old was transported to Erie County Medical Center for severe leg injuries.
The operator and only occupant of the Ford, a 17-year-old male, was taken to Erie County Medical Center.
No arrest has been made at this time.
NYSP Bureau of Criminal Investigation, Community Stabilization Unit and the Niagara County District Attorney’s Office are assisting in this investigation.
